Arsenal beat Argentinos

Arsenal defeated Argentinos by 2-1 in the opening match of the third round of the Final Tournament held at the Diego Armando Maradona stadium.

Arsenal's Julio César Furch opened the score at 20' of the second half, while his teammate Carlos Carbonero netted four minutes later.

The only goal of the local team was scored by Leandro Barrera 5' before the end of the game.



Line-ups:

Argentinos Juniors: Nereo Fernández; Ariel Garcé, Matías Martínez, Aníbal Matellán and Diego Placente; Marcos Figueroa, Matías Laba, Gaspar Iñiguez and Juan Ramírez; Damián Villalva and Juan Luis Anangonó. Coach: Gabriel Schurrer.

Arsenal: Cristian Campestrini; Hugo Nervo, Lisandro López, Diego Braghieri and Damián Pérez; Carlos Carbonero, Iván Marcone, Jorge Ortíz and Martín Rolle; Emilio Zelaya and Julio Furch. Coach: Gustavo Marcone.

Stadium: Argentinos.

Referee: Fernando Rapallini.
